Button: 'A lot of work still to be done'
Jenson Button says there is 'a lot of work still to be done' at McLaren ahead of this weekend's Malaysian Grand Prix, following a difficult day of practice at the Sepang International Circuit.
The Brit isn't happy with his long run pace and feels the MP4-29 is struggling in the high-speed corners. He finished the opening session in fourth place before setting the eighth fastest time in second practice, completing 48 laps overall.
